Thompson, Brownlee lift Ginebra to 3-2 edge in PBA Finals

Scottie Thompson and Justin Brownlee took charge in crunch time as Barangay Ginebra pulled off a 73-66 comeback win over TNT Tropang Giga in Game 5 of the PBA Commissioner’s Cup Finals on Sunday at the Smart Araneta Coliseum.

Down 65-66 with over four minutes left, Thompson delivered back-to-back baskets to put the Gin Kings ahead before Brownlee sealed the win with four straight points in the final minutes.

Brownlee, playing through a thumb injury, posted 18 points, 14 rebounds, and five assists, while Thompson tallied 16 points, 10 rebounds, and five assists. Japeth Aguilar and Maverick Ahanmisi added 11 points apiece as Ginebra moved one win away from their 16th PBA title.

“Even if Justin made big shots down the stretch, it was Scottie’s inspiration that turned the tide for us,” said head coach Tim Cone.

Rondae Hollis-Jefferson and Rey Nambatac led TNT with 19 points each, but the Tropang Giga struggled after leading by 10 points in the first half.

Game 6 is set for Wednesday night.
